State Goals for the 2009-2011 Biennium

  • To help plan and host an outstanding International Convention.
  • To provide leadership and professional development for all women educators.
  • To enthusiastically recruit active and newly retired educators and scholarship candidates.
  • To increase personal skills in technology, advocacy for the arts and empowered meaningful service in our communities and the world.
  • To be informed on critical issues for women, education and children and take non-partisan action as appropriate.
  • To continue to offer leadership and personal growth opportunities at Creative Arts and Rainbow Lodge retreats.

Elevator Speech: Alpha Sigma State of The Delta Kappa Gamma Society International is a professional organization of over 1100 women educators in 47 chapters across Washington State.  We provide leadership, professional and personal growth opportunities through area workshops, state meetings and retreats.
